    noisey problems???

    just a couple of temp related querries for the "experts" amongst us,
    my T5 has got a bailey piston DV fitted but when the engines cold it sounds very different,
    not so much hiss, more like the standard blow off bassey chirp, WHY???

    also i,m still getting the rough boosting sometimes, only when the engine is hot,
    its like a pinking, missfire, chirping from the back of the engine and it runs flat while doing this, ideas???
    the only thing ive not checked is the actuator, could this be the problem? could it be losing boost?

    if so, how do you alter them to cope with extra boost levels???

    Hi nath did you fit the standard bcs back or have you still got the mbc on if you have got the bcs on they can go down and cause spikes and a slight miss or lumpy when on full boost also all of the turbo engines ive had are flat on boost when cold if i were you i would only start to boot it when it is fully warm to save engine damage as for the dv not sounding correct i would say its caused by the low of flat boost when cold i wouldnt worrie about it also is it a twin piston dv or a single one due to some single ones are prone to a split diaphram and that can cause problems with misses and spikes

    im unsure about the acuator my forge dv doesnt dump under 3k and most time it has to be on full boost to get a really good sound out of it i know that there are different strenght springs in the dv myne could be a strong one that takes quite abit of pressure to open if yours is dumping all of the time it could have a weak spring in it did the dv come with the car or did you buy it new
